kaybams1:


Its simple bro. The annual salary differential between the private sector worker and that of the government worker is around 840k (in other words, the private worker earns 840k more than the government worker annually). If the government worker is an industrious investor, he can be saving around 40% of his income (that's around 30k) for a spate of say 5 years. His annual savings will be around 360k.

Since government jobs are flexible and they give you time to pursue other endeavours, he can invest that annual savings of 360k in a viable business that will bring him a monthly 15% Return on Investment (ROI). That's like 648k extra income for the government worker. The wage differential between them has now reduced to 192k.

Now imagine that the government worker reinvests like 70% of that 648k extra income he earned (that's approximately 454k) in the second year in another viable business that will bring him that same 15% ROI monthly. In the second year the government worker will be having an annual 816.48k extra income. If you add this extra income to the government worker's normal annual income, his gross income will be totalling around 1.8million.

This means he's now earning almost a million more than our private employee in just the second year. Now let's imagine if this government worker keeps reinvesting like 60% of that extra income the subsequent years, he will be swimming in millions in just 5 years. But our private worker won't be given the time the government worker has to pursue this entrepreneurial endeavour thereby making his pay stagnant.

Your salary isn't what makes you a wealthy man, its a job that provides you sufficient time and steady income to finance your entrepreneurial dream. You can take this fact to the bank.

Re: Pros And Cons Of Government Jobs by bukatyne(f): 1:49pm On May 13, 2015
I will pick standard private (or nationals) and multinationals any day

No to one man business ( I am guessing that is most of the private firms people refer to). The rate of 'insecurity' in the private world is not as bad as painted especially for nationals and multinationals.

No to civil service jobs either (except public appointments and some elect juicy parastatals).

The average civil service job is not for a young vibrant person who wants to build a career. The office politics is also crazy and there is crab mentality there.

However, if a person is more business oriented and wants a white collar job for a while, Civil service is for you. It would also help for people who want to further their education. People also sometimes build great networks with top politicians.
